Cutting-edge Control Actions Applied



Executing advanced termite control methods is vital in guarding the historical honesty of the building while effectively combating the problem. One cutting-edge procedure includes using non-repellent liquid termiticides. Another cutting-edge method is the installment of termite baiting systems. These systems make use of termite attractants combined with slow-acting toxicants. Termites feed on the bait, share it with their colony members, and inevitably remove the entire populace. This targeted technique is environmentally friendly and minimally intrusive, making it optimal for historical structures where protecting the original framework is critical.

Moreover, utilizing infrared innovation for termite detection has changed control actions. Infrared video cameras can detect warmth trademarks indicating termite activity behind wall surfaces or within frameworks. This non-invasive method allows for exact targeting of therapy, lowering damages to the structure while effectively removing the termites. By incorporating these cutting-edge control actions, the historic structure can be shielded from termites without jeopardizing its architectural importance.
